Element UI 组件 Dialog 中 before-close 与 close 的区别
cnblogs 2024-09-14 17:11:00 阅读 98
<el-dialog
width="600px"
:title="title"
:visible.sync="dialogVisible"
:close-on-click-modal="false"
:before-close="handleBeforeClose"
@open="handleOpen"
@close="handleClose"
>
总结:
1、点击 ”x“ 或”取消“按钮会依次调用 handleBeforeClose()、handleClose() ,点击”确定“按钮仅调用handleBeforeClose()
2、若想在点击确定后关闭弹窗或处理其他逻辑,应使用 before-close。因为点击”x“ 或”取消“按钮本身就会关闭弹窗,无须额外处理
上一篇: 前端使用 Konva 实现可视化设计器(21)- 绘制图形(椭圆)
下一篇: 一款免费、简单、快速的JS打印插件,web 打印组件,基于JavaScript开发,支持数据分组,快速分页批量预览,打印,转pdf,移动端,PC端
本文标签
声明
本文内容仅代表作者观点,或转载于其他网站,本站不以此文作为商业用途
如有涉及侵权,请联系本站进行删除
转载本站原创文章,请注明来源及作者。